Abstract

The utility model discloses a miniature camera, and the camera comprises a camera body which is provided with a built-in rechargeable camera body, and a portable power supply charging the camera battery. According to the utility model, the miniature camera comprises the portable power supply, which is used for charging the rechargeable camera battery, in the camera body, so the portable power supply can be used for charging the battery when the camera battery of the camera body is low in power and nearly has no power, thereby achieving that the portable power supply supplies power to the camera battery in the miniature camera, enabling the camera to be used continuously, and bringing convenience to persons.

Description

A kind of micro-camera
Technical field
The utility model relates to household appliance technical field, in particular, relates to a kind of micro-camera.
Background technology
People are usually with camera or mobile phone photograph sheet, and general mobile phone pixel is lower, and the effect of taking a picture can not show a candle to the photo that camera is taken.Particularly, in going out or travelling, camera has seemed into people's necessary article; But camera volume is large, in carrying process, have inconvenience, due to Portable belt not, thereby bring the inconvenience in use to people.
I have designed a kind of micro-camera, and volume is little, easy to carry and use.Micro-camera comprises housing, is arranged on battery and circuit board in housing, and circuit board is provided with camera and the switch for taking pictures, and on circuit board, is also provided with the placement section coordinating with SD card for storing the photo of shooting; Battery is micro-camera power supply.This scheme is unexposed.Because micro-camera volume is little, battery volume is also little, and the electricity capacity of battery is few, thereby can not be micro-camera power supply for a long time.
Utility model content
Technical problem to be solved in the utility model is to provide the micro-camera that battery can be powered for a long time.
The purpose of this utility model is achieved through the following technical solutions: a kind of micro-camera, comprises and be built-in with the camera body of chargeable camera battery and the portable power source for described camera battery charging.
Preferably, described portable power source comprises power-supply battery, circuit board, connecting line for placing the holder of described power-supply battery and circuit board and being connected with described camera body.This is the concrete composition structure of portable power source, portable power source is connected with camera body by connecting line, and for the camera battery in camera body charges, once camera battery electric weight in camera body low can be just that it charges by portable power source, thereby be convenient for people to use.
Preferably, described camera body comprises the usb interface being connected with computer by usb data line; Described connecting line one end is provided with the usb joint of pegging graft with described usb interface, and the other end is provided with attaching plug; Described circuit board is provided with the outlet being connected with described attaching plug.This is the concrete mode that portable power source is connected with camera body by connecting line.
Preferably, described holder entirety is cylindrical structure.The convenient production of holder of cylindrical structure, and be easy to carry.
Preferably, described holder one end is provided with the opening for placing power-supply battery, and described portable power source also comprises the closing cap of the described opening of a sealing.Power-supply battery is put in holder from opening part, closing cap sealing opening, thus power-supply battery is firmly fixed in holder.
Preferably, described closing cap and holder are spirally connected fixing.The fixation that is spirally connected, is convenient to realize.
Preferably, the lateral wall of described closing cap is provided with screw thread, described holder described parameatal madial wall be provided with described closing cap on the screw thread being spirally connected of threaded engagement.This is closing cap and the holder concrete mode of fixing one that is spirally connected.
Preferably, described closing cap is provided with a circle depression, and the screw thread on described closing cap is arranged on described recess, and the external diameter of described depression equals the diameter of described opening, and the external diameter of described closing cap equals the external diameter of described holder.Arrange like this that to make closing cap be fixed on holder rear surface smooth, make connection between closing cap and holder more closely, fixing more firm.
Preferably, described holder is provided with the placement platform for placing described circuit board on described parameatal sidewall; Described placement platform equals the thickness sum at height and the described circuit board edge of described depression to the distance on described opening edge edge; When described closing cap and described holder are spirally connected when fixing, the edge of described closing cap compresses described circuit board.Holder arranges placement platform and places circuit board on parameatal sidewall, then, by fixing between closing cap and holder, circuit board is fixed, thereby circuit board is fixed between holder and closing cap, and fixation.
Preferably, described closing cap is provided with the through hole for dodging described outlet, and described closing cap is provided with the groove caving inward, and described through hole is arranged on described groove.The groove that is arranged on closing cap for the through hole of dodging outlet, prevent that outlet from stretching out outside closing cap, so just outlet is had to protective effect, prevent that outlet is impaired.
The utility model is because micro-camera comprises a portable power source for the chargeable camera battery charging in camera body, can not have electricity in the time that the camera battery electric weight of camera body is low time, can be its charging by portable power source, thereby the camera battery in micro-camera is powered by portable power source, so just can continue to use micro-camera to take pictures, be convenient for people to use.

Embodiment
Below in conjunction with accompanying drawing and preferred embodiment, the utility model is described in further detail.
The utility model discloses a kind of micro-camera, as shown in Figures 1 to 7, comprises and is built-in with the camera body 100 of chargeable camera battery and the portable power source 200 for described camera battery charging.The utility model is because micro-camera comprises a portable power source 200 for the chargeable camera battery charging in camera body 100, can not have electricity in the time that the camera battery electric weight of camera body 100 is low time, can be its charging by portable power source 200, thereby the camera battery in micro-camera is powered by portable power source 200, so just can continue to use micro-camera to take pictures, be convenient for people to use.
As shown in Figures 2 and 3, portable power source 200 comprises power-supply battery 6, circuit board 4, connecting line (not shown) for placing the holder 2 of power-supply battery 6 and being connected with camera body, portable power source 200 is connected with camera body by connecting line, and be the camera battery charging in camera body, once the low portable power source 200 that just can pass through of camera battery electric weight in camera body be that it charges, thereby is convenient for people to use.This connecting line one end is provided with usb joint and is connected with camera body, as shown in Figure 1, camera body 100 is provided with usb interface 13, camera body 100 is connected with computer with usb data line by usb interface, thereby the picture in camera body 100 can be moved and deposits in computer, and the usb joint of usb interface 13 and connecting line is connected cooperation, thereby be camera battery charging by portable power source 200.The connecting line other end is provided with plug and is connected with portable power source 200; Shown in Fig. 6, the circuit board 4 of portable power source 200 is provided with outlet 41 for coordinating with plug, and as can be seen from Figure 2, outlet 41 protrudes in the outside of holder 2, thereby convenience and plug are connected.Just portable power source 200 and camera body 100 are communicated with by connecting line like this, thereby are convenient to portable power source 200 for the camera battery charging in camera body 100, so that camera body 100 can be taken pictures for a long time.
As shown in Figure 4, the entirety of holder 2 is cylindrical structure, and certainly, holder 2 also can be arranged to other structure.Holder 2 one end are provided with opening 21, thereby by opening 21 is just convenient, power-supply battery are put in holder 2; Shown in Fig. 2, Fig. 3 and Fig. 7, portable power source 200 also comprises the closing cap 3 of this opening 21 of a sealing, thereby just power-supply battery 6 firmly can be fixed in holder 2 by closing cap 3.Fixing by being spirally connected between the present embodiment closing cap 3 and holder 2, the fixation that is spirally connected, is convenient to realize; Certainly, between closing cap 3 and holder 2, also can adopt alternate manner to be fixed, and be detachable fixing, the detachable fixing power-supply battery 6 that is just convenient for changing between closing cap 3 and holder 2.The utility model holder 2 is socketed on closing cap 3 and is fixed, concrete, holder 2 is provided with screw thread on the madial wall around its opening 21, in conjunction with Fig. 5, the lateral wall of closing cap 3 is provided with the screw thread being spirally connected with the opening 21 of holder 2 threaded engagement around, fixing thereby holder 2 is socketed on closing cap 3.
As shown in Figure 5, closing cap 3 is provided with a circle depression 31, screw thread on closing cap 3 is arranged on depression 31 places, in conjunction with Fig. 4, the external diameter of depression 31 equals the diameter of opening 21, the external diameter of closing cap 3 equals the external diameter of holder 2, arranges like this that to make closing cap 3 be fixed on holder 2 rear surface smooth, make connection between closing cap 3 and holder 2 more closely, fixing more firm.As shown in Figure 7, circuit board 4 is fixed between holder 2 and closing cap 3, as can be seen from Figure 4, holder 2 is provided with the placement platform 22 for placing circuit board 4 on the sidewall around its opening 21, be that the root that holder 2 arranges screw thread around its opening 21 is provided with this placement platform 22 for limit circuit plate 4, placement platform 22 is to the distance at these opening 21 edges equal to cave in 31 height and the thickness sum at circuit board 4 edges, when closing cap 3 and holder 2 are spirally connected when fixing, the edge of closing cap 3 presses circuit board 4, circuit board 4 is near placement platform 21, thereby circuit board 4 is firmly fixed between holder 2 and closing cap 3, and there is gap after preventing from being connected and fixed between closing cap 3 and holder 2.Certainly, the present embodiment also can be socketed in closing cap 3 on holder 2 and be fixed, and can play so approximate effect.
As Fig. 2, shown in Fig. 5 and Fig. 7, closing cap 3 is provided with the through hole 32 for dodging the outlet 41 on circuit board 4, this through hole 32 is circular port, through hole 32 coordinates the size setting of outlet, thereby make to coordinate stable, outlet 41 protrudes outside closing cap 3, closing cap 3 is provided with the groove 33 caving inward, through hole 32 is arranged on this groove, groove 33 places that are arranged on closing cap 3 for the through hole 32 of dodging outlet 41 are prevented to outlet 41 stretches out outside closing cap 3, outlet 41 is still positioned at groove 33 sidewall around, so just outlet 41 is had to protective effect, prevent that outlet 41 is impaired.
As shown in Figure 5, the corresponding holder of closing cap 3 is also arranged to cylindrical structure, and is provided with rounding at the edge, one end that is provided with groove 33, and the edge of closing cap 3 does not just have corner angle like this, good looking appearance, and prevent corner angle injury user.This groove 33 is loop configuration, and the groove 33 of loop configuration is convenient to produce, good looking appearance.
As shown in Figure 4, one end of holder 2 is provided with opening 21 and closing cap is fixed, and circuit board is fixed between the two.The other end of holder 2 is also provided with opening (not shown), claims that this opening is after-opening here.As shown in Fig. 2, Fig. 3 and Fig. 7, portable power source 200 also comprises the bonnet 5 of the after-opening of a sealing holder, between bonnet 5 and holder 2, be also spirally connected fixing, bonnet 5 is socketed on holder 2, concrete, the inside surface of bonnet 5 is provided with screw thread, and the outside surface of holder 2 is provided with the screw thread being spirally connected with the threaded engagement of bonnet 5, thereby firmly fixing between bonnet 5 and holder 2.Portable power source 200 also comprises that one is placed on the spring 7 in bonnet 5.Thereby can see in Fig. 7, power-supply battery 6 is placed on the interior one end of holder 2 and is connected with spring 7, and the other end is connected with circuit board 4, circuit board 4 needs to be connected and can to form loop with power-supply battery 6 two ends, charges.The present embodiment bonnet 5 and holder 2 are all that metal material is made, there is good conducting function, certainly, also metal material of spring 7, in conjunction with Fig. 4, the edge of circuit board 4 is placed on the placement platform 22 of holder 2, and the edge of circuit board 4 is provided with the metal for conducting electricity, thereby circuit board 4 is realized conducting.The present embodiment also can arrange one for by the passage of wire on the madial wall of holder 2, wire one end linking springs 7, other end connecting circuit board 4.Certainly, can also just for other mode, power-supply battery 6 be connected with circuit board 4.
In the present embodiment, closing cap 3 is made for transparent plastic material, and the state of circuit board 4 is just conveniently watched in the transparent setting of closing cap 3, is convenient for people to use.And closing cap 3 contacts and conducts electricity with circuit board 4 for plastic material just prevents closing cap 3.
In the present embodiment, power-supply battery 6 is dry cell, easy to use, certainly, also can adopt other battery as power-supply battery 6, such as button cell.
In the present embodiment, holder 2 is arranged to cylindrical structure, and dry cell is also cylindrical structure, arranges like this and coordinates dry cell setting, certainly, also holder 2 can be arranged to other structure.
As shown in Figure 1, camera body 100 is provided with camera 11, and camera body 100 comprises housing, and corresponding camera 11 parts of housing are protruded forward setting, so just conveniently take pictures.Camera body 100 also comprises the switch 12 for taking pictures, and switch 12 comprises the first switch for taking pictures and the second switch for making a video recording, and micro-camera not only can be taken pictures like this, but also can make a video recording, and is convenient to people and uses.Camera body 100 also comprises flashlamp 14, and flashlamp 14 and camera 11 are arranged on the same face, and in the time taking pictures, flashlamp sends light, is convenient to take pictures.Camera body 100 volumes of the utility model micro-camera are little, are easy to carry; And portable power source volume is also little, be easy to carry, be especially convenient for people to out using.
